Output 58ff3703ea5697513b7d4f27a85f02172de0d965d34ef5f74a72c69f67c2023e:1

value
26316
script pubkey
OP_0 OP_PUSHBYTES_20 b23dc909a75b6b6973acdb3982f45dde88bdda24
address
bc1qkg7ujzd8td4kjuavmvuc9azam6ytmk3yqjjdc2
transaction
58ff3703ea5697513b7d4f27a85f02172de0d965d34ef5f74a72c69f67c2023e